PFG Assumptions and Statements for Manufacture of qty 30
Cable Harness 2590-99-346-8876 by ACME Engineering Birmingham
Assumptions
1 ACME will be using their manual construction method.2 All 30 items will be manufactured in one batch3 All components have been purchased by the Company, there will be no GFS.4 Equality of Information between PFG and Company.5 The Nyvin cable for each branch is fed down the heatshrink sleeving all at one time
Statements
1 All in house manufacture2 ACME will be costing the IAW of these cables according to their agreed QMAC.3 Cost of cables will be Ex-Works to MoD4 We have examined the harness drawings to derive the best estimating technique for this item. Because the harness is very different to other harnesses
for this and other vehicles that we have costed and estimated previously, we will not be able to use comparative estimating techniques. 5 Because the harness is new to us we have decided to use a full detail 3point estimate.6 Cost of materials has been verified by examination of the invoices received by ACME for the materials ordered for this project7 PFG have used the Company Work breakdown Structure to generate the 3 point estimate model8 We have investigated the work breakdown structure to assess if there are any correlated variables9 Because the harness will be manufactured by a manual process we have assessed the value of the Learner Curve as being 85%
10 We will apply Predict at 50% Project Beta Distribution to the Price Build

PFG Estimates of Labour Estimate for Cable Harness 2590-99-346-8876
Estimated Time (Minutes)
Taskoperative
description
Lower Run
minimum Mid RunUpper Run
Collation of Parts Kit Storeman 8 12 158 12 15
Measure and Cut Nyvin to Length (qty 9) Elec Fitter 9 11 13Feed Nyvin cables into heatshrink sleeving (Qty 9)Elec Fitter 20 25 35Use heat gun to shrink heatshrink sleeving onto Nyvin CableElec Fitter 15 20 25Feed into Megamyde Sheathing Elec Fitter 10 15 20Fit identification sleeves to outside of megamide(qty4)Elec Fitter 4 6 8Use heatgun to shrink cable identification sleeves (qty 4)Elec Fitter 1.5 2.5 4Fit sleeve identification (qty 13) Elec Fitter 4.5 5.5 8Bare cable ends (qty 17) Elec Fitter 3 4 5Tin cable ends with solder (qty 17) Elec Fitter 4 5 7Tin solder cups on connectors items 18,23,27 Elec Fitter 3 4 5Assemble connectors (items 18,23,27) onto connectors (item 10)Elec Fitter 3 5 7Solder connections on connectors Elec Fitter 8 10 12Assemble connectors Elec Fitter 4 5 6Fit grommet (item2) into connector item 1 Elec Fitter 1 1.5 2Assemble connector item 1 onto cable harness Elec Fitter 8 10 15Fit cap plug protective item no3 onto cable harness (qty3)Elec Fitter 2 3 4
100 132.5 176
Visually Inspect cable harness for defects Snr Examiner 5 7 9Fit harness to automatic harness test machine Snr Examiner 1 1.5 2Run automatic cable test Snr Examiner 0.5 0.7 1Remove harness from harness test machine Snr Examiner 0.2 0.3 0.4Move harness to stores Snr Examiner 3 5 8
9.7 14.5 20.4
From QMAC Storeman and Snr Examiner are in-direct workers
Electrical Fitter is a direct workerTherefore PFG will only estimate for the direct portion of the process
Elec Fitter 100 132.5 176
Personnal Allowance 15% 15 19.875 26.4Total Time= 115 152.38 202.4
Apply Predict to Electrical Fitter estimatePredict Output = 127.883 Minutes Converting to hrs = 2.13 Hours
Apply Learner Model to Predict OutputApplication of learner model to asembly time gives an aveage batch value of 2.08 Hrs per harness
Total time required to complete quantity 30 harnesses =62.46 Hours

Price Build for Warrior Cable Harness NSN 2590-99-346-8876
Bill of Materials
Cost of materials for qty 1 cable harness = £713.70
Cost of materials for qty 30 cable harnesses = £21,411.11
Labour Estimate
Time to manufacture harness = 2.08 Hours
Time to manufacture qty 30 harnesses = 62.46 Hours
MoD Agreed Rate for ACME Engineering = £43.56 per Hour
Therefore labour cost for harness = £90.69 per harness
Total labour cost for qty 30 harnesses = £2,720.77
Sub total= £804.40 per harnessG&A Rate 5% £40.22 per harness
Profit rate 9.23% £77.96 per harness
Total Cost for qty 1 harness = £922.57
Total Cost for qty 30 harnesses = £27,677.22
